Output 8a376e9af123b626adc9013db76f210d891a04e22737fcfb0916f6b017bcd32d:21

value
26239307
script pubkey
OP_0 OP_PUSHBYTES_20 6f5f96e16f5686d073d21ce4776051b0e3fb8cbd
address
bc1qda0edct026rdqu7jrnj8wcz3kr3lhr9a66zl8w
transaction
8a376e9af123b626adc9013db76f210d891a04e22737fcfb0916f6b017bcd32d
spent
true